大
|
dà
|
- big; large; great
- older (than another person)
- eldest (as in 大姐 dàjiě)
- greatly; freely; fully
- (dialect) father
- (dialect) uncle (father's brother)

司马
|
Sīmǎ
|
- Minister of War (official title in pre-Han Chinese states)
- two-character surname Sima
